At the group’s MYS press conference its strong financial position was emphasised as well as the sizeable investment being made in superyachts through its CRN, Riva, Pershing and Custom Line brands. CRN has delivered three superyachts this year, including the 62m Rio, and has also signed two new orders with the 85m yard number 144 and the 70m yard number 145. The 85m will be the largest superyacht ordered from CRN. Other new models announced were the Custom Line Navetta 50, the Pershing 170, Riva 54 Metri and the Wally 130 and 150

BAGILETTO LAUNCH NEW T60 superyacht project
New 60m T60 superyacht project by Francesco Paszkowski Design, a top-of-the-range yacht that marks the evolution from the traditional Seagull line. The T60 weighs in at around 1,000 GT. It is based on the successful T52, for which the shipyard has already secured six orders. Baglietto will soon begin the construction, on spec, of the first T60 with delivery scheduled for the end of 2025

GULF CRAFT LAUNCH MAJESTY 160
Shipyard Gulf Craft has pulled the wraps off a new model during the Monaco Yacht Show. Named the Majesty 160, the composite model will measure roughly 49 metres and has been designed by Cristiano Gatto. The Majesty 160 will be the second largest project for the shipyard following the Majesty 180, the largest composite production boat. ever built. Built to the specifications outlined by the Bureau Veritas Commercial Yacht Rules for yachts under 500 gross tonnage (GT), the Majesty 160 has a gross tonnage of 498 meeting all safety requirements of a vessel of 500 GT.

MEYER YACHTS LAUNCH Mayer 12 Concept TWO10
The German shipbuilder celebrated the first anniversary of its entry into the yacht market with the launch of the Meyer 210 concept TWO10, to add to its Meyer 150 launched last year. The profile of the TWO10 is kept flat; however, a look at the decks illustrates the yacht’s enormous size. Technically, the TWO10 relies on green propulsion solutions, for example with fuel cells and battery systems.

Nautor has revealed details of its new Swan 128 project which is currently taking shape at its yard in Pietarsaari, Finland. The hull plug has already been completed. The collaboration between Frers studio, the shipyard’s interiors department and architect Misa Poggi has led to an optimal and flexible layout, with a large owner’s quarters in the foreship area and a generous aft crew area.

SUNSEEKER REVEALED details of the Ocean 460
The UK boatbuilder introduced its new Middle East distributor, Sunseeker Gulf, and revealed details of the Ocean 460 – a tri-deck superyacht with round-bilge semi-displacement hull. It is the first to feature a vertical bow, and its 31ft beam allows for 25% more interior volume than her sister ship, the 131 Yacht

WIDER YACHT in built 72m superyacht and launched a line of catamarans
Wider has in build a 72m superyacht and has launched a line of catamarans including the Widercat 92, of which it plans to build 10 a year. Wider has a new large build facility in Venice and is developing a new-build plant in Fano
